PEOPLE v. BUCHANAN


57 A.D.2d 971 (1977)

The People of the State of New York, Respondent, v. Rebecca Buchanan, Appellant

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Third Department.

May 5, 1977


On April 16, 1976, while in the company of Tim Buchanan in his automobile on Eagle Street in the City of Albany, the defendant withdrew from her purse a .22 calibre handgun which she discharged into Buchanan's head thereby causing his death. As a result of this incident, the Grand Jury of the County of Albany charged the defendant in a four-count indictment with murder in the second degree, manslaughter in the first and second degree...
